Terry,

Today market-wise, we have a decay of momentum. Technically speaking, over-all volume has been drying up or waning as you Terry said earlier about Bollinger bands. The fore mentioned points to be a general weakening of the QQQQ.

stockcharts.com[h,a]daclyyay[db][pd20,2!i][vc60][iLp14,3,3!La12,26,9]&pref=G

All boats (stock) rise and fall on the QQQQ waters via a rising or a falling (technical) tide.

The “key” for tomorrow is the 20 EMA. If the 20-EMA does indeed get breached, Then expect ALL tech players to follow.

Or…If the there is a bounce of the QQQQ at the 20-EMA tomorrow, expect a similar bounce to take place in most of the techs.
